Truck driver ticketed after sudden stop on Florida interstate sends lumber crashing through cab
A truck driver was cited following a load shift and lumber spill in Hillsborough County, Florida, on Thursday. The incident occurred around 7:20 a.m. on July 16 on I-75 near Apollo Beach, Florida. The Florida Highway Patrol (FHP) said that a 31-year-old truck driver hauling a load of lumber braked suddenly due to traffic, causing the lumber to crash forward into the cab of the truck and to spill off the trailer onto the roadway.
